如何实现Python函数执行超时的两种有效处理策略?
- 内容介绍
- 文章标签
- 相关推荐
本文共计448个文字,预计阅读时间需要2分钟。
背景:最近写了自动化需求,需要下载APK,但有时候部分包下载很慢,影响整体测试时间。所有需要设定下载超时自动退出。
方法一:使用`func_timeout`模块的`@func_set_timeout()`来实现
步骤:
1.安装`func_timeout`模块
背景
最近写了自动化需要下载apk,但有时候部分包下载很慢,影响整体测试时间,所有需要设定下载超时自动退出。
本文共计448个文字,预计阅读时间需要2分钟。
背景:最近写了自动化需求,需要下载APK,但有时候部分包下载很慢,影响整体测试时间。所有需要设定下载超时自动退出。
方法一:使用`func_timeout`模块的`@func_set_timeout()`来实现
步骤:
1.安装`func_timeout`模块
背景
最近写了自动化需要下载apk,但有时候部分包下载很慢,影响整体测试时间,所有需要设定下载超时自动退出。

